G191 WKL is a 2005 Vespa (douglas) PX125E in Black with a 125c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 81.8%.
Across all 2005 Vespa (douglas) PX125E models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.9% with a typical mileage of 24,012 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Vespa (douglas) PX125E fails its MOT is direction indicators not working, accounting for 23 recorded failures. If you're considering buying G191 WKL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Vespa (douglas) PX125E typically stays on UK roads for around 44 years. At 21 years old, this Vespa (douglas) PX125E is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
